North West Official Opening event in Braybrook:
showcasing our program highlights for 2018.

We were delighted to launch the Official Opening of our North West Office in Braybrook on Wednesday 17 October, 2018.  The Hon. Marsha Thomson MP, State Member for Footscray, Concern Australia Ambassadors, Justin and Lauren Bowen, our Founder, Rev. Dr. John Smith and his wife Glena, along with past and present Board Members, staff, volunteers, supporters and friends come along to this event.

Starting with a Welcome to Country and Smoking Ceremony from Wurundjeri Elder Ron Jones, guests were invited into our new premises with a sense of belonging and pride understanding some of the local history.

Our Chair, David Eldrige AM, presented program highlights and achievements from the past year. David acknowledged the Board, leadership team, staff, volunteers and all of our generous supporters who have helped us work towards our VISION2020.

This past financial year we have helped:

  • 48 students learn through the Hand Brake Turn program;
  • 47 young people have been housed and helped with the support of 30 Live In Mentors alongside our youth workers, housing officers and case workers through Inside Out;
  • 53 children have participated in fun filled learning activities through our LiveWires program at Collinwood Housing Estate;
  • 100 young men have been supported at Malmsbury Youth Justice Centre;
  • 95 people have been helped through the STEPS Outreach program and we have supported young people on the streets 47/52 weeks of the year; and
  • 26,709 students took part in 359 seminars through our Values for Life program.
